lib/layout.ex

defmodule Dialup.Layout do
@moduledoc """
The behaviour and macro for Dialup layout modules.
A layout wraps one or more pages with shared chrome (navigation, footer, etc.).
Layouts are discovered automatically based on the directory hierarchy:
app/
├── layout.ex # wraps all pages under app/
└── blog/
├── layout.ex # wraps all pages under app/blog/ (nested)
└── [slug]/
└── page.ex
## Usage
defmodule MyApp.App.Layout do
use Dialup.Layout
# Called once when the WebSocket connection is established.
# Use it to set session-scoped data (e.g. the current user).
def mount(session) do
user = Repo.get(User, session[:user_id])
{:ok, Map.put(session, :current_user, user)}
end
def render(assigns) do
~H\"\"\"
<nav>{@current_user.name}</nav>
<main>{raw(@inner_content)}</main>
\"\"\"
end
end
## Callbacks
- `mount/1` — optional; called once when the WebSocket connection is established.
Receives the current session map (empty `%{}` for the root layout, or whatever the
parent layout returned). Return `{:ok, new_session}`.
- `render/1` — renders the layout HTML using HEEx. Use `{raw(@inner_content)}` to
inject the child content.
## Colocation CSS
Place a `layout.css` file in the same directory as `layout.ex`. The styles are
automatically scoped and applied to all pages under that directory at compile time.
## Nesting
Layout `mount/1` calls are chained from outermost to innermost. Each layout receives
the session returned by its parent and may enrich it further.
"""
@callback render(assigns :: map()) :: Phoenix.LiveView.Rendered.t()
# session :: 親レイアウトが設定したsession(rootレイアウトは %{} を受け取る)
@callback mount(session :: map()) :: {:ok, map()}
@optional_callbacks mount: 1
defmacro __using__(_opts) do
quote do
@behaviour Dialup.Layout
import Phoenix.Component
import Phoenix.HTML, only: [raw: 1]
import Dialup.Page, only: [overwrite: 2, set_default: 2]
# デフォルト実装:何もしない(mountを定義しないlayoutはsessionに何も追加しない)
def mount(session), do: {:ok, session}
defoverridable mount: 1
@before_compile Dialup.Layout
end
end
defmacro __before_compile__(env) do
template_path = env.file |> Path.rootname(".ex") |> Kernel.<>(".html.heex")
has_render = Module.defines?(env.module, {:render, 1})
has_template = File.exists?(template_path)
render_quote =
cond do
has_render ->
quote do
end
has_template ->
source = File.read!(template_path)
compiled =
EEx.compile_string(source,
engine: Phoenix.LiveView.TagEngine,
line: 1,
file: template_path,
caller: __CALLER__,
source: source,
tag_handler: Phoenix.LiveView.HTMLEngine
)
quote do
@external_resource unquote(template_path)
def render(assigns) do
_ = assigns
unquote(compiled)
end
end
true ->
raise CompileError,
file: env.file,
line: env.line,
description:
"#{inspect(env.module)} must define render/1 or provide #{Path.basename(template_path)}"
end
css_path = env.file |> Path.rootname(".ex") |> Kernel.<>(".css")
css_quote =
if File.exists?(css_path) do
css_content = File.read!(css_path)
scope_class =
"d-" <>
(env.module
|> Atom.to_string()
|> :erlang.md5()
|> Base.encode16(case: :lower)
|> binary_part(0, 7))
scoped_css = ".#{scope_class} {\n#{css_content}\n}"
quote do
@external_resource unquote(css_path)
def __css__, do: unquote(scoped_css)
def __css_scope__, do: unquote(scope_class)
end
else
quote do
def __css__, do: nil
def __css_scope__, do: nil
end
end
quote do
unquote(render_quote)
unquote(css_quote)
end
end
end
